One of Cornwall’s best kept secrets, Kingsand is a few minutes walk from the adjacent village of Cawsand. The beaches are perfect for safe swimming, water sports and rock pooling. Kingsand boasts a range of excellent pubs, cafes, gift shops, an art gallery and deli. The stunning Whitsand Bay is close by and offers miles of golden sandy beach, a surf school, coasteering and spectacular coastal walks.

My husband and I have two children and in 1997 we moved from London with our two young children for an idyllic life in Cornwall. We did indeed have 7 fabulous years in Kingsand until family circumstances meant that we had to move back to London for a time. Kingsand is a truly unique place which we all love and miss greatly. We hope you too enjoy our wonderful home and village.
Why they chose this property
Whilst on a tour of Cornwall with a friend I visited Kingsand almost by accident.
On the same trip we visited St Ives, Rock, Padstow and other famous places in Cornwall but for us, none of them compared. We hear this time and again from people who visit.
We feel Kingsand is quite a unique place and hard not to fall in love with.The village is a really friendly place, very much unchanged by time and stunning whatever the weather. Visitors always comment on how much their children love the freedom they are afforded by the safety in the village, a rare thing today. A favorite with little visitors is being sent to the shop, money and list in hand getting the Sunday paper and fresh baked croissants…..very grown up.
